We do not ignore the alarm: GUR warned about new threats from Russia

Andrii Chernyak, a representative of the Main Intelligence Directorate of the Ministry of Defense of Ukraine, said that the Armed Forces of the Russian Federation used all possible means of war against Ukraine, but you can expect anything from dictator Vladimir Putin. He stressed that air raid signals should not be ignored and that one should protect oneself as the threat continues.

"The Russians do not know how to wage war honestly, they do not observe international law. Therefore, the alarm cannot be ignored, it is necessary to hide," said Chernyak on the air of the telethon.

At the same time, answering journalists' questions about the probability of strikes on Ukraine during the winter holidays or before the inauguration of the newly elected US President Donald Trump, Chernyak emphasized that the strikes will continue. "The enemy will continue to use drones, cruise missiles and ballistic missiles. Russia is trying to show its strength, although it is already exhausting itself," he added.

Chernyak also pointed out that Russia is trying to create the latest weapons in order to demonstrate its power as a superpower to the world, although the real situation is much more difficult for the aggressor.

"Do not underestimate alarm signals. Everything indicates that you and I will see the end of Putin and his regime," the intelligence representative concluded.

Meanwhile, active fighting continues at the front. Defense forces of Ukraine repulsed the enemy near Pishchany in Donetsk region, and also continue to oppose the Russian offensive in Kharkiv region, in particular in the areas of Dvorichny and Lozova.
